

He was born in Concord, MA on April 27, 1945 to the late Ivan and Emma (Whitney) Nelson. After completing high school he served his country for 7 years in the sub-service of the US Navy until his honorable discharge. Thereafter he worked as a Nuclear Operator at Millstone.
On July 30, 1967 he married his beloved wife Carolyn (Petherick) in Framingham, MA. Together they raised their family locally. Larry loved woodworking, cabinet making and was a true craftsman making furniture for family and friends. He and Carolyn enjoyed camping seasonally with their friends. Larry also enjoyed his time at the slots. He had a love of family which included Loki and Bibby, his “grand-labs”.
He is survived by his wife, sons James Nelson and wife Lois, Wynne Nelson and wife Linda, sister; Lois Anderson, grandson; Tyler Lawrence Nelson, and many nieces and nephews. He was predeceased by his brothers Robert and Gordon, and one sister, Thelma.
